Some truckers plan boycott over Arizona immigration law
[snip] Two or three times a week, truck driver Jesus Serrano hauls loads of Mexican-grown produce from warehouses in Nogales, Ariz., which is just across the U.S.-Mexico border, to distribution centers in Los Angeles.
Serrano plans to stop making the trip now that Arizona Republican Gov. Jan Brewer has signed a stringent anti-illegal immigration bill into law, however, and he’s recruited other truckers to join him.
“We’re Hispanic; we’re Mexican. We’ve been saying, ‘Are we going to be getting stopped on our way to the store when we’re walking to get lunch somewhere?’ “ Serrano said.
About 40 percent of the Mexican-grown produce that’s consumed in North America comes through Nogales, according to Amy Adams, a spokeswoman with the Fresh Produce Association of the Americas. Serrano said that a revolt among independent truckers would create backlogs in moving that produce out of Nogales warehouses.
However, Collin Stewart, the chairman of the Arizona Trucking Association, hadn’t heard of the boycott plans and said he wouldn’t expect what he described as a “CB radio revolt” by independent owner-operators to affect distribution significantly.
